(57) [Summary] [Purpose] To provide a foldable multi-tiered parking frame that can be used simply by transporting it to the site and deploying it, and saves space when stored. [Structure] A bottom frame 20 which supports the whole in contact with the installation ground and provides a parking space at the bottom, a rear support frame 30 which is in a horizontal state when folded and is in an upright state when used, and an upright state of the rear support frame. The bracing member 40 to be held, the bottom frame and the rear frame are rotatably supported by the rear support frame in a state in which there is a predetermined gap in the vertical direction, and the upper part has a longer protruding length of the front part. Multiple upper parking plates 5
0, and an elevating / lowering support part 60 for supporting the front part of each upper parking plate so as to be capable of elevating / lowering.

本考案は、車両を駐車するための多段駐車装置に関する。 The present invention relates to a multi-level parking device for parking a vehicle.

【0002】[0002]

【従来の技術】[Prior art]

従来の多段駐車装置は、設置現場において各部品の組立を行なわなければなら ないようになっている。しかるに、設置現場はとかく周囲の状況やスペースの関 係から組立作業に種々の制約を受け易い。このため、設置作業が面倒であり、多 くの時間を必要とする。また、他の場所に移すについても大変面倒であり、一時 的に倉庫等に保管しようとしてもほとんど不可能である。 In the conventional multi-level parking system, each part has to be assembled at the installation site. However, the installation site is subject to various restrictions on the assembly work due to the surrounding conditions and space. Therefore, the installation work is troublesome and requires a lot of time. Also, it is very troublesome to move it to another place, and it is almost impossible to temporarily store it in a warehouse or the like.

【0003】 また、従来の多段駐車装置は、上段の車両の出し入れについて、非常に複雑な 動力機構を用いて下段の車両を回避するか、あるいは下段に駐車されている車両 を動かす必要があった。したがって、前者の場合には装置の大型化及びコストア ップを招くし、さらに車両の出し入れに長時間を要する等の短所があり、また後 者には、車両の出し入れに多くの制約を受けるという短所がある。In addition, in the conventional multi-stage parking apparatus, it is necessary to use a very complicated power mechanism to avoid the vehicle in the lower stage or move the vehicle parked in the lower stage when the vehicle in the upper stage is taken in and out. . Therefore, in the former case, there is a disadvantage that it causes an increase in the size and cost of the device, and in addition that it takes a long time to move the vehicle in and out, and in the latter case, there are many restrictions on the moving in and out of the vehicle. There are disadvantages.

【0004】[0004]

【考案が解決しょうとする課題】[Issues to be solved by the device]

このような事情を背景にしてなされたのが本考案で、設置現場での面倒な組立 が不要であり、しかも上段の車両の出し入れを極めて簡単な構造で下段の車両と の干渉を生じることなく行なえるようにした折り畳み式多段駐車装置の提供を目 的としている。 The present invention has been made against such a circumstance, and the troublesome assembly at the installation site is unnecessary, and the vehicle in the upper tier is extremely easy to take in and out without causing interference with the vehicle in the lower tier. The aim is to provide a folding multi-level parking system that can be operated.

【0005】[0005]

【課題を解決するための手段】[Means for Solving the Problems]

本考案による折り畳み式多段駐車装置は、設置場所の地面に接して全体を支え ると共に、最下段の駐車スペースを与える底部枠と、底部枠に回動可能に接続さ れ、底部枠への接続部を支点に回動させることにより折り畳み時に横倒状態され 使用時に直立状態とされる後部支持枠と、後部支持枠の直立状態を保持するため の筋かい部材と、底部枠及び互いに上下方向で所定の間隔を持つ状態にして後部 支持枠に後部を回動可能に支持され且つ上方のものほど前部の迫り出し長さが長 くされた複数の上部駐車プレートと、各上部駐車プレートの前部を昇降可能に支 持する昇降支持部とを備えてなっている。 The foldable multi-level parking device according to the present invention supports the whole in contact with the ground at the installation site, and is rotatably connected to the bottom frame that provides the lowermost parking space and connected to the bottom frame. The rear support frame is turned upside down when folded by turning it to a fulcrum so that it is in an upright state when used, the bracing members for maintaining the upright state of the rear support frame, the bottom frame, and the vertical direction with respect to each other. A plurality of upper parking plates whose rear portions are rotatably supported by a rear support frame with a predetermined interval and whose front part has a longer protruding length, and the front of each upper parking plate. It is provided with an elevating and lowering support part for supporting the elevating and lowering part.

【0006】 この折り畳み式多段駐車装置は、予め組み立てたものを折り畳み状態で設置現 場に運び、そこで展開するだけで直ぐ使用可能な状態とすることができる。この 展開は、後部支持枠を直立状態にしてこれを固定するだけでよく、そのためには 筋かい部材で後部支持枠を支えるだけで済む。This foldable multi-level parking apparatus can be put into a ready-to-use state by simply carrying a pre-assembled one in a folded state to the installation site and unfolding it there. For this deployment, all that is required is to fix the rear support frame in an upright state, and for that purpose, only support the rear support frame with bracing members.

【0007】 上部駐車プレートへの駐車は、昇降支持部により前部を下降させて上部駐車プ レートを前方傾斜状態とし、この前方傾斜状態の上部駐車プレートに車両を乗り 入れることにより行なわれる。この際に前方傾斜する上部駐車プレートは、上方 のものほどその前部の迫り出し長さが長くされいるので、下段に駐車中の車両と 干渉することがない。したがって、下段の車両の移動を全く必要としない。Parking on the upper parking plate is performed by lowering the front part by the elevating and lowering support part to bring the upper parking plate into a forward inclined state, and riding the vehicle on the upper parking plate in the forward inclined state. At this time, the upper parking plate that inclines forward has a longer protruding length at the front part as it goes up, so it does not interfere with the vehicle parked in the lower tier. Therefore, it is not necessary to move the lower vehicle.

【0008】 本考案では、このような折り畳み式多段駐車装置について、上部駐車プレート に昇るためのタラップを設け、上部駐車プレートに駐車する使用者の便宜を図る ようにしている。According to the present invention, the folding multi-stage parking device is provided with a ramp for ascending to the upper parking plate for the convenience of the user who parks on the upper parking plate.

【0009】 また、本考案では、上部駐車プレートの前部先端に傾斜緩和プレートを設ける と、上部駐車プレートへの車両の出し入れ時に車両前部又は後部のスポイラーや マフラー等がプレートに接触することがなくなり、車両の出し入れがよりスムー ズに行なえるようになり好ましい。また、このような傾斜緩和プレートは前後動 可能にすれば必要に応じて傾斜角度をさらに調節することができ、より好ましい 。また、傾斜緩和プレートにキャスタを取り付けるようにすれば前後動が容易に なり、さらに好ましい。Further, according to the present invention, when the tilt relaxing plate is provided at the front end of the upper parking plate, the spoiler or muffler at the front or rear of the vehicle may come into contact with the plate when the vehicle is taken in or out of the upper parking plate. This is preferable because it will be eliminated and the vehicle can be taken in and out more smoothly. Further, it is more preferable that such a tilt moderating plate can be moved back and forth so that the tilt angle can be further adjusted as needed. Further, it is more preferable to attach casters to the inclination relaxation plate because the forward and backward movements will be easy.

【0010】 さらに、本考案では、不必要な時には収納可能とされたキャスタを底部枠に取 り付け、折り畳み式多段駐車装置の移動が必要な場合には楽に移動できるように することも可能である。Further, according to the present invention, it is possible to attach casters that can be stored when unnecessary to the bottom frame so that they can be easily moved when the folding multi-stage parking device needs to be moved. is there.

以下、本考案に係わる好適な実施例を図面に基づいて説明する。 図1に本考案の第1実施例に係る折り畳み式多段駐車装置が示される。この折 り畳み式多段駐車装置は、主に、底部枠20、後部支持枠30、筋かい部材40 、複数の上部駐車プレート50、50(この例では2台分)及び各上部駐車プレ ート50ごとに設けられる昇降支持部60から構成されている。 Hereinafter, a preferred emb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ings. FIG. 1 shows a folding type multistage parking apparatus according to a first embodiment of the present invention. This foldable multi-stage parking device mainly includes a bottom frame 20, a rear support frame 30, bracing members 40, a plurality of upper parking plates 50, 50 (for two vehicles in this example), and each upper parking plate. Each of the 50 includes an elevating / lowering support portion 60.

【0012】 底部枠20は、本多段駐車装置を所定の場所に設置した際に地面に接して全体 を支えると共に、最下段の駐車スペースを与えるためのもので、1台の自動車を 収納できるだけの面積を有する方形状に形成されている。The bottom frame 20 supports the whole of the multi-tiered parking device in contact with the ground when the multi-tiered parking device is installed at a predetermined place, and also provides a parking space at the bottom, so that only one vehicle can be stored in the bottom frame 20. It is formed in a square shape having an area.

【0013】 後部支持枠30は、門形に形成されており、その基端部が底部枠20の側面に ヒンジ接続され、このヒンジ接続部を支点に回動可能とされている。The rear support frame 30 is formed in a gate shape, and its base end is hinge-connected to the side surface of the bottom frame 20, and is rotatable about this hinge connection.

【0014】 筋かい部材40は、本多段駐車装置の使用時に後部支持枠30を底部枠20に 対し直立状態に保持するためのもので、曲折可能であると共にロック手段46に より曲折不能とできるようにされた関節部40jを中間部に有する構造とされ、 一端が底部枠20の側面に、他端が後部支持枠30の側面にそれぞれヒンジ接続 で接続されている。つまり、ロック手段46による伸張状態において後部支持枠 30の直立状態を保持する一方で、ロック手段46を解除して図5に示すように 関節部40jを曲折させれば後部支持枠30が横倒状態になって全体が折り畳め る。The brace member 40 is for holding the rear support frame 30 in an upright state with respect to the bottom frame 20 when the present multi-stage parking device is used, and is bendable and non-bendable by the locking means 46. The joint portion 40j thus configured has an intermediate portion, and one end is connected to the side surface of the bottom frame 20 and the other end is connected to the side surface of the rear support frame 30 by hinge connection. That is, while the rear support frame 30 is kept upright in the extended state by the locking means 46, the rear support frame 30 is laid sideways if the locking means 46 is released and the joint portion 40j is bent as shown in FIG. It will be in a state and the whole can be folded.

【0015】 多段駐車を可能とする上部駐車プレート50は、その後部が底部枠20及び他 の上部駐車プレート50に対し所定の間隔、つまり車両を収納するのに十分な間 隔を上下方向に設けた状態で後部支持枠30に接続されている。この後部支持枠 30への接続もヒンジ接続とされており、従って、上部駐車プレート50は、後 部支持枠30への接続部を支点に回動可能な状態となっている。一方、上部駐車 プレート50の前部は、伸縮可能に形成され一端が底部枠20に接続された昇降 支持部60で支持されると共に、筋かい部材40と同様の関節部80jを有し一 端が底部枠20に接続された前部支持部材80により支持されている。The upper parking plate 50 that enables multi-level parking is provided with a rear portion thereof at a predetermined distance from the bottom frame 20 and the other upper parking plates 50, that is, a sufficient vertical distance for accommodating a vehicle. It is connected to the rear support frame 30 in a closed state. The connection to the rear support frame 30 is also a hinge connection, so that the upper parking plate 50 is in a state of being rotatable around the connection portion to the rear support frame 30 as a fulcrum. On the other hand, the front portion of the upper parking plate 50 is supported by an elevating / lowering support portion 60 which is formed to be extendable and has one end connected to the bottom frame 20, and has a joint portion 80j similar to the brace member 40. Are supported by a front support member 80 connected to the bottom frame 20.

【0016】 これら昇降支持部60及び前部支持部材80の接続部は何れもヒンジ接続とさ れている。従って、上部駐車プレート50は、昇降支持部60が伸びることによ る水平状態(図1及び図3)と昇降支持部60が縮むと共に前部支持部材80が 曲折することによる下方傾斜状態(図4)を取り得るようになっている。The connecting portions of the elevating support portion 60 and the front support member 80 are both hinged. Therefore, the upper parking plate 50 is in a horizontal state (FIGS. 1 and 3) due to the elevating and lowering support portion 60 extending, and in a downward inclined state due to the elevating and lowering support portion 60 contracting and the front support member 80 bending (see FIG. 4) can be taken.

【0017】 また、上部駐車プレート50は、上方のものほど前部の迫り出し長さが長くさ れ、上記下方傾斜状態において他の上部駐車プレート50上の車両と干渉しない ようにされると共に、先端部に傾斜緩和プレート54が設けられている。Further, the upper parking plate 50 has a longer front protruding length as it goes upward, so that it does not interfere with other vehicles on the upper parking plate 50 in the downward tilted state. An inclination relaxation plate 54 is provided at the tip.

【0018】 傾斜緩和プレート54は、上部駐車プレート50の前部先端に形成のガイド溝 50aに係合突起54aを介して係合する構造とされている。したがって、傾斜 緩和プレート54は、ガイド溝50aに沿って前後に移動できるようになってお り、この前後動を滑らかにするために、キャスタ54bが取り付けられている。 この傾斜緩和プレート54は、図4に見られる如く、上部駐車プレート50が下 方傾斜した際に、上部駐車プレート50より緩やかな角度を地面に対し形成する もので、この結果、上部駐車プレート50への車両の出し入れに際して、車両前 後部にあるスポイラーやマフラー等をこする可能性がなくなる。The tilt relaxing plate 54 is structured to engage with a guide groove 50a formed at the front end of the upper parking plate 50 via an engaging protrusion 54a. Therefore, the tilt relaxing plate 54 can be moved back and forth along the guide groove 50a, and casters 54b are attached to smooth the forward and backward movement. As shown in FIG. 4, when the upper parking plate 50 inclines downward, the inclination relaxing plate 54 forms a gentler angle with respect to the ground than the upper parking plate 50. As a result, the upper parking plate 50 is formed. There is no possibility of rubbing the spoiler or muffler at the front and rear of the vehicle when moving the vehicle in and out of the vehicle.

【0019】 上部駐車プレート50には駐車中の車両の動きを止めるためのタイヤ止め52 が形成されることになるが、このタイヤ止め52は図1のように凹み構造とする ようにしてもよいし、また図2に示すような構造にすることもできる。 図2のタイヤ止め52は、上部駐車プレート50に回動可能に接続されたレバ ー52a、レバー52aを上部駐車プレート50の上面に突出させる方向に付勢 するスプリング52b、及びレバー52aをスプリング52bの付勢力に抗して 引っ込ませるための液圧シリンダー52cから構成されている。すなわち、レバ ー52aは、侵入してきた車両が乗るとその重みで引っ込み、車両が通り過ぎる とスプリング52bの付勢力で突出して車両の固定に働く。一方、車両を取り出 す際には、液圧シリンダー52cで引っ込めてレバー52aによる固定を解除す る。The upper parking plate 50 is formed with a tire stopper 52 for stopping the movement of the parked vehicle. The tire stopper 52 may have a recessed structure as shown in FIG. Alternatively, the structure shown in FIG. 2 may be used. The tire stopper 52 shown in FIG. 2 includes a lever 52a that is rotatably connected to the upper parking plate 50, a spring 52b that urges the lever 52a in a direction in which the lever 52a projects to the upper surface of the upper parking plate 50, and a lever 52a that is a spring 52b. It is composed of a hydraulic cylinder 52c for retracting against the urging force of. That is, the lever 52a is retracted by the weight of the invading vehicle when the vehicle rides on the lever 52a, and protrudes by the urging force of the spring 52b when the vehicle passes by and works to fix the vehicle. On the other hand, when the vehicle is taken out, it is retracted by the hydraulic cylinder 52c and the fixation by the lever 52a is released.

【0020】 この多段駐車装置には、例えばチェーンのようなものを採用したタラップ70 が取り付けられ、上部駐車プレート50に駐車する運転者の便宜が図られている 。また、底部枠20の地面側に不必要時には収納可能とされたキャスタ90(図 5に図示)が取り付けられ、移動や運搬を楽に行えるようにされている。The multi-level parking apparatus is provided with a ramp 70 that employs, for example, a chain, for the convenience of the driver who parks on the upper parking plate 50. A caster 90 (shown in FIG. 5) that can be stored when not needed is attached to the ground side of the bottom frame 20 so that the caster 90 can be easily moved and transported.

【0021】 以下、このような折り畳み式多段駐車装置の使用状態について説明する。この 折り畳み式多段駐車装置は、その組立は予め工場で行なわれ、図5に示すような 折り畳み状態で設置現場に運ばれて来る。そして、図1および図3のように、設 置現場で後部支持枠30を直立状態とすると共に、筋かい部材40を前記の如く ロック手段46により伸張状態にし、この後部支持枠30を直立状態に固定する だけで使用可能となる。The usage state of such a foldable multi-stage parking device will be described below. This foldable multi-stage parking device is assembled in advance in a factory and is brought to the installation site in a folded state as shown in FIG. Then, as shown in FIGS. 1 and 3, the rear support frame 30 is set upright at the installation site, and the brace members 40 are extended by the locking means 46 as described above, and the rear support frame 30 is set upright. It can be used only by fixing it to.

【0022】 底部枠20つまり最下段への駐車については何らの操作を必要とせず車両10 をそのまま底部枠20による駐車スペース内に進入・停止させるだけでよい。上 部駐車プレート50への駐車については、図4に示したように、先ず昇降支持部 60を縮めて上部駐車プレート50を下方傾斜させ、その先端を接地させる。こ の際に傾斜緩和プレート54が上部駐車プレート50より緩やかな角度で接地し 上部駐車プレート50への車両12の乗入れが容易化されることは前述の通りで ある。この状態で、上部駐車プレート50に、タイヤ止め52で固定できる状態 にまで車両を乗り入れる。それから、昇降支持部60を伸ばして上部駐車プレー ト50を水平状態に戻す。No operation is required for parking at the bottom frame 20, that is, at the lowermost stage, and the vehicle 10 may simply enter and stop in the parking space by the bottom frame 20. Regarding parking on the upper parking plate 50, as shown in FIG. 4, first, the elevating and lowering support part 60 is contracted to incline the upper parking plate 50 downward, and the tip thereof is grounded. At this time, the inclination easing plate 54 is grounded at a gentler angle than the upper parking plate 50 to facilitate the entry of the vehicle 12 into the upper parking plate 50, as described above. In this state, the vehicle is mounted on the upper parking plate 50 until it can be fixed with the tire stopper 52. Then, the lift support 60 is extended to return the upper parking plate 50 to the horizontal state.

【0023】 以下、図6〜図9を参照しながら、本考案に係る折り畳み式多段駐車装置の第 2、第3及び第4実施例を説明する。 図6と図7とに示される第2実施例が図1の第1実施例と異なる点は、以下の 通りである。すなわち、第1実施例では上部駐車プレート50と底部枠20とに 接続さていた伸縮性の昇降支持部60を、後部支持枠30と前部支持部材80と に接続させ、この昇降支持部60の伸縮で前部支持部材80を強制的に曲折・伸 張させて上部駐車プレート50の操作を行なうようにした点である。Hereinafter, second, third and fourth embodiments of the folding multi-stage parking apparatus according to the present invention will be described with reference to FIGS. 6 to 9. The second embodiment shown in FIGS. 6 and 7 is different from the first embodiment in FIG. 1 in the following points. That is, in the first embodiment, the stretchable lift support portion 60, which was connected to the upper parking plate 50 and the bottom frame 20, is connected to the rear support frame 30 and the front support member 80, and the lift support portion 60 The point is that the front support member 80 is forcibly bent and extended by expansion and contraction to operate the upper parking plate 50.

【0024】 図8の第3実施例及び図9の第4実施例は、それぞれ図1の第1実施例と図6 の第2実施例との変形例で、上部駐車プレート50が1段だけ設けられる2段構 造とされている。The third embodiment of FIG. 8 and the fourth embodiment of FIG. 9 are modifications of the first embodiment of FIG. 1 and the second embodiment of FIG. 6, respectively, and the upper parking plate 50 has only one step. It has a two-tiered structure.

以上説明した本考案に係る折り畳み式多段駐車装置は、以下のような効果を有 する。 全ての部品を予め工場で組み立てたものを折り畳んだ状態で設置現場に運ぶ ことができ、しかも設置現場での展開は後部支持枠を直立状態とするだけでよい ので、種々の制約を受け易い設置現場での作業量が少なくて済み、設置を簡単且 つ迅速に行なえる。 必要に応じて他の設置場所への移動を簡単に行なえるし、さらに折り畳めば 占有スペースが小さくて済むので倉庫等への一時的保管が可能である。 下段の車両との干渉がないので車両の出し入れを短時間で行なえ、しかもそ の機構が極めて簡単なものなので、装置の大型化及びコストアップを招かずに済 む。 The foldable multi-stage parking device according to the present invention described above has the following effects. All parts are assembled in the factory in advance and can be transported to the installation site in a folded state, and further, deployment at the installation site only requires the rear support frame to be in an upright state, so installation that is susceptible to various restrictions The amount of work on site is small, and installation is easy and quick. If necessary, it can be easily moved to another location, and if it is folded, it occupies a small space and can be temporarily stored in a warehouse. Since there is no interference with the vehicle in the lower stage, the vehicle can be taken in and out in a short time, and the mechanism is extremely simple, so that the device does not become large and the cost does not increase.
